From a008afe1398f1d2f1a1d089d3cbbd9ab2d389bed Mon Sep 17 00:00:00 2001 From: Ivan Date: Thu, 16 Apr 2026 00:52:45 -0500 Subject: [PATCH] feat(locales): add UI transparency and glass effect settings in German, English, Italian, and Russian translations; include descriptions for new appearance options --- meshchatx/src/frontend/locales/de.json | 5 +++++ meshchatx/src/frontend/locales/en.json | 5 +++++ meshchatx/src/frontend/locales/it.json | 5 +++++ meshchatx/src/frontend/locales/ru.json | 5 +++++ 4 files changed, 20 insertions(+) diff --git a/meshchatx/src/frontend/locales/de.json b/meshchatx/src/frontend/locales/de.json index bd3e11e..88bacee 100644 --- a/meshchatx/src/frontend/locales/de.json +++ b/meshchatx/src/frontend/locales/de.json @@ -74,6 +74,11 @@ "copy": "Kopieren", "appearance": "Erscheinungsbild", "appearance_description": "Wechseln Sie jederzeit zwischen hellen und dunklen Voreinstellungen.", + "ui_transparency": "Hintergrundtransparenz", + "ui_transparency_description": "Erhöht die Durchsichtigkeit des Haupt-Hintergrunds. Seitenleisten bleiben deckend.", + "ui_glass_enabled": "Glaseffekt", + "ui_glass_enabled_description": "Milchglas-Unschärfe bei Glaskarten. Aus: undurchsichtige Flächen.", + "reset_appearance_defaults": "Erscheinungsbild auf Standard zurücksetzen", "light_theme": "Helles Thema", "dark_theme": "Dunkles Thema", "live_preview": "Live-Vorschau wird sofort aktualisiert.", diff --git a/meshchatx/src/frontend/locales/en.json b/meshchatx/src/frontend/locales/en.json index a5df787..acf5561 100644 --- a/meshchatx/src/frontend/locales/en.json +++ b/meshchatx/src/frontend/locales/en.json @@ -80,6 +80,11 @@ "copy": "Copy", "appearance": "Appearance", "appearance_description": "Switch between light and dark presets anytime.", + "ui_transparency": "Background transparency", + "ui_transparency_description": "Increases see-through on the main shell background. Side panels stay solid for readability.", + "ui_glass_enabled": "Glass effect", + "ui_glass_enabled_description": "Frosted blur on glass-style cards. When off, cards use solid surfaces.", + "reset_appearance_defaults": "Reset appearance to defaults", "light_theme": "Light Theme", "dark_theme": "Dark Theme", "live_preview": "Live preview updates instantly.", diff --git a/meshchatx/src/frontend/locales/it.json b/meshchatx/src/frontend/locales/it.json index f00b256..0b2c136 100644 --- a/meshchatx/src/frontend/locales/it.json +++ b/meshchatx/src/frontend/locales/it.json @@ -80,6 +80,11 @@ "copy": "Copia", "appearance": "Aspetto", "appearance_description": "Passa tra i temi chiaro e scuro in qualsiasi momento.", + "ui_transparency": "Trasparenza dello sfondo", + "ui_transparency_description": "Aumenta la trasparenza dello sfondo principale. I pannelli laterali restano opachi.", + "ui_glass_enabled": "Effetto vetro", + "ui_glass_enabled_description": "Sfocatura vetro sulle schede stile glass. Disattivato: superfici solide.", + "reset_appearance_defaults": "Ripristina aspetto predefinito", "light_theme": "Tema Chiaro", "dark_theme": "Tema Scuro", "live_preview": "L'anteprima si aggiorna istantaneamente.", diff --git a/meshchatx/src/frontend/locales/ru.json b/meshchatx/src/frontend/locales/ru.json index 672ac9c..4a23cdb 100644 --- a/meshchatx/src/frontend/locales/ru.json +++ b/meshchatx/src/frontend/locales/ru.json @@ -74,6 +74,11 @@ "copy": "Копировать", "appearance": "Внешний вид", "appearance_description": "Переключайтесь между светлой и темной темами в любое время.", + "ui_transparency": "Прозрачность фона", + "ui_transparency_description": "Усиливает просвечивание основного фона. Боковые панели остаются непрозрачными.", + "ui_glass_enabled": "Эффект стекла", + "ui_glass_enabled_description": "Матовое размытие для «стеклянных» карточек. Выкл. — сплошные поверхности.", + "reset_appearance_defaults": "Сбросить оформление к умолчаниям", "light_theme": "Светлая тема", "dark_theme": "Темная тема", "live_preview": "Предпросмотр обновляется мгновенно.",